Customer Service is dedicated to operational excellence and innovative thinking through our workforce in our call center, field operations, billing and payment center, outage and demand-side management and other service offerings.We are currently looking for two new Sr. Project Managers to join our Building Electrification (BE) team. One will be focused on the development of electrification programs for existing residential and commercial buildings and the other one will be focused on the overall BE program strategy, planning and market development for both new and existing buildings.The job is…As a Senior Project Manager, you will provide vision, innovation, and direction, project management, cross-organization coordination/functionality for SCE’s Building Electrification (BE) initiative. The ultimate objective is to develop BE programs targeting multiple segments in the residential and nonresidential markets while carefully managing distribution impacts and grid harmonization. Your responsibilities will be directly linked to SCE’s Clean Power and Electrification Pathway where we identify the need to electrify 30% of buildings by 2030 and up to 75% by 2045 in order to meet the State’s greenhouse gas (GHG) reduction goals. The projects lead by you, will have enterprise-wide operational impacts and require new and innovative thinking, as BE is a nascent business. Your role will require a great depth of understanding of the markets we’re targeting, close coordination with the demand-side management (DSM) portfolios within Customer Service, forging new working groups with a variety of areas within T&D and Strategic Planning and Operational Performance, and side-by-side alignment with Regulatory. Project responsibilities include identifying specific objectives and milestones, project team membership, scope, schedule, budget and regulatory impacts. Externally, this position will interface with regulatory agencies such as the CPUC, the CEC, CARB, environmental stakeholders such as NRDC and Sierra Club, other IOUs, industry leadership (e.g. Building Decarbonization Coalition), residential and commercial property managers, and interaction and coordination with the applicable supply chain within these market segments, as well as extreme critics of BE.
